Platinum, Old Cut and Rose Cut Diamonds Belle Epoque Pendant, circa 1910. Platinum Chain.

This beautiful Belle Epoque necklace is composed of a platinum motif set with rose-cut diamonds and four old cut diamonds. It ends with a small diamond pendant. It has a platinum chain with two spring rings to attach it from the front. It is openwork and light to wear. It is a charming piece.

The Art-Deco jewelry (1910-1935)

In rupture with the Art-Nouveau movement and yielding to the desire of simplicity, symmetry and aesthetic order, a movement emerges and asserts itself from 1910. But it is after the first world war, in 1925, during the international exhibition of decorative arts that the Art-deco style prevails.

This new jewelry is set with precious or semi-precious stones previously unused. Their design follows the geometric shapes of clothing and accessories and platinum is essential. 

Cartier, Boucheron, Van Cleef and Arpels, Mauboussin are at the forefront of creativity during these years.
